Internet Explorer shutdown to cause Japan headaches ‘for months’


TOKYO — Microsoft bids farewell to Internet Explorer on Thursday, stirring a sense of panic among many businesses and government agencies in Japan that waited to update their websites until the last minute. Since April, Tokyo-based software developer Computer Engineering & Consulting has been inundated with requests for help. Those customers are mostly government agencies, financial institutions and manufacturing and logistics companies that operate websites only compatible with Internet Explorer.
